Neighbors CB. CBer using a high powered linear amplifier? This is a tough issue. Common capacitor bypassing at the effected gear to remove the interference is not good for a pristine audio signal. Are all cable connections tight? Bad solder connection in the amp? Poor connections act like a diode to RF and will demodulate AM on the CB transmitter carrier.

Unlikely the signal is getting into the audio gear via the power cord, but a pair of .01 @ 1000VDC ceramic caps may help across the hot & neutral with each cap to the ground wire. No ground wire? The chassis may float up to 60 volts above ground with current in the micro amp range.
